Sikkim has not reported any
COVID-19 case so far, a senior health official said on Friday.
The authorities have collected samples of 35 people, but their reports have come out negative, Director General (Health Services) P T Bhutia said.
"There has been no case of COVID-19 in Sikkim till date," he said.
However, eight patients with coronavirus-like symptoms are admitted in various hospitals, Bhutia said.
A total of 1,122 persons have been placed under home quarantine, while another 107 are being quarantined at government facilities in Sikkim.
